A sharp, compassionate and darkly funny play about alcohol, denial and the damage hidden in plain sight. As a wedding approaches, old wounds resurface and loyalties are tested. Honest, unsettling and full of humanity, it explores addiction, family strain and the possibility of change. Ruby doesn’t think she has a problem Maggie’s almost six months into recovery Then there’s Callum….. Family, friendship and booze Drinking to remember And drinking to forget How do you navigate sobriety in a world that revolves around drink? Buckled follows three lives caught in the pull of alcohol: a son struggling to forgive, a mother facing sobriety one day at a time, and a friend edging towards her own reckoning. By turns witty, tender and devastating, Helen Jeffery’s play is an honest, humane portrait of dependence, denial and the fragile hope of recovery. CAST: 3 DURATION: 60 minutes
